Vanguard Mega Cap Growth ETF

897 hedge funds and large institutions have $16.6B invested in Vanguard Mega Cap Growth ETF in 2025 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 93 funds opening new positions, 310 increasing their positions, 273 reducing their positions, and 41 closing their positions.
